Nelson Annandale

Nelson Annandale

Nelson Annandale, more precisely Thomas Nelson Annandale, was a prominent British scientist with a diverse range of expertise ( Here's a summary of his accomplishments:

Found 1 books in total
Freshwater Sponges, Hydroids & Polyzoa
Freshwater Sponges, Hydroids & Polyzoa by Nelson Annandale, published in 1911,...
Books per page: